This Part applies to — (a) the use, handling and storage of hazardous chemicals at a workplace and the generation of hazardous substances at a workplace; and (b) a pipeline used to convey a hazardous chemical.
This Part does not apply to hazardous chemicals and explosives being transported by road, rail, sea or air if the transport is regulated under another written law.

This Part applies to explosive power tools that are designed to be supported by hand.
Subject to this regulation, this Part applies to all plant.
Subject to subregulation (3), this Part does not apply to plant that — (a) relies exclusively on manual power for its operation; and (b) is designed to be primarily supported by hand.
